BOSTON'S 33 ARCH STREET AWARDED LEED-GOLD

by admin

BOSTON — The U.S. Green Building Council has awarded LEED-Gold certification to 33 Arch Street in Boston. The designation was awarded under the LEED for Existing Buildings: Operations and Maintenance program. The building rises 33 stories and contains 600,000 square feet of Class A office space. It is located in the heart of the city's Financial District. A joint venture between AREA Property Partners and SITQ owns the building, which was constructed in 2006, and recently completed a $3 million renovation program. CB Richard Ellis / New England leases and manages the property.
